Hello, Am 21.02.19 um 19:21 schrieb Vahid Bashiri via dia-list: > Hi > I'd like to use the specific xml format of Dia in my application to > store diagrams. Because of the non GNU code I am using, I decided to > write my own code similar to Dia which is greatly inspired by it (but > not copied). My question is if I use the xml format, will I have a > licencing problem. Is the file format licenced GNU too or I can use it > in proprietary application?
what you are asking is, as far as I see a legal question, which I am not qualified enough to answer. But I doubt very much this could be a problem. However, leaving apart the legal question, this is also a moral question: i.e. will the "Dia community" let me use Dia's XML format in a proprietary product?
